We have shipped it all over the world via postal delivery, even as far as America and Australia. pop up room in a bagWebSep 3, 2024 · While jerky originated in North America, biltong came from South African countries like Zimbabwe, Namibia, Botswana, and Zambia. The indigenous people of these countries preserved meat by slicing it into strips, curing it, then hanging it up to dry. The ideal temperature and drying time for biltong is 22°C to 24°C for the first 24 hours and thereafter at 30°C to 33°C for two days. Keeping below 24°C in the initial phases stops the fats from going rancid.
